There is something truly magical about a rich, silky chocolate drizzle that elevates any dessert to a whole new level, which is why I am so excited to share this Homemade Chocolate Sauce Recipe with you. This recipe transforms simple pantry staples into a luscious sauce bursting with deep cocoa flavor. With just a few ingredients and less than ten minutes, you can whip up a versatile sauce perfect for ice cream, pancakes, or even a decadent cup of chocolate milk. I guarantee once you try this, store-bought chocolate syrups will become a thing of the past!

Ingredients You’ll Need
The beauty of this Homemade Chocolate Sauce Recipe lies in its simplicity—the ingredients are straightforward yet each one plays a vital role in creating a velvety, perfectly balanced chocolate treat.
- 1 cup unsweetened cocoa powder: Provides intense chocolate flavor and the deep color.
- 1 cup granulated sugar: Adds sweetness and helps thicken the sauce as it cooks.
- 1 cup water: Creates a smooth, pourable consistency for the sauce.
- 1/4 teaspoon salt: Enhances the chocolate taste and balances the sweetness.
- 1 teaspoon vanilla extract: Introduces a warm, aromatic note that rounds out the flavor beautifully.
How to Make Homemade Chocolate Sauce Recipe
Step 1: Combine Dry Ingredients
Start by whisking together the cocoa powder, granulated sugar, and salt in a medium saucepan. This step ensures even distribution of flavor and prevents clumps from forming when you add the liquid.
Step 2: Add Water Gradually
Slowly pour in the water while whisking continuously. This gradual blending helps create a smooth, lump-free chocolate base that will cook evenly.
Step 3: Heat the Mixture
Place your saucepan over medium heat, bringing the mixture to a gentle boil while stirring frequently. This prevents the cocoa and sugar from burning on the bottom and helps the sauce thicken evenly.
Step 4: Simmer and Thicken
Once boiling, reduce the heat and let the sauce simmer for 4 to 5 minutes, stirring occasionally. You’ll notice the sauce gradually thickens into a luscious, glossy texture that clings perfectly to whatever it’s drizzled over.
Step 5: Stir in Vanilla and Cool
Remove the saucepan from heat and stir in the vanilla extract for that added depth and warmth. Allow the sauce to cool down before transferring it to a jar or bottle—this helps it thicken even more as it cools.
How to Serve Homemade Chocolate Sauce Recipe

Garnishes
This chocolate sauce pairs amazingly well with a variety of garnishes. Sprinkle some chopped nuts, fresh berries, or a dusting of sea salt for a delightful contrast. A dollop of whipped cream alongside the sauce can turn a simple dessert into a showstopper.
Side Dishes
Drizzle this sauce over vanilla ice cream, warm pancakes, or fluffy waffles for an indulgent breakfast or dessert. It’s also fantastic as a dip for fresh fruit like strawberries or banana slices—anytime you need that little extra chocolate kick.
Creative Ways to Present
Get creative by swirling the sauce into yogurt bowls, blending it into milk for a quick chocolate drink, or even layering it between cake tiers as a moist, rich filling. This Homemade Chocolate Sauce Recipe is your new secret weapon for impressive, chocolaty presentations.
Make Ahead and Storage
Storing Leftovers
You can store any leftover chocolate sauce in the refrigerator in a sealed jar or bottle for up to two weeks. Just make sure to give it a good stir or shake before using, as some settling might occur.
Freezing
While this sauce freezes well, I recommend freezing in small portions to easily thaw just the amount you need later. Use freezer-safe containers and consume within two months to maintain peak flavor and texture.
Reheating
Reheat your sauce gently in the microwave or on the stovetop over low heat, stirring frequently until it returns to its smooth, pourable state. Avoid overheating to keep the sauce silky rather than grainy.
FAQs
Can I use milk instead of water in this Homemade Chocolate Sauce Recipe?
Absolutely! Using milk or even cream instead of water will create a richer, creamier sauce. Just keep an eye on the thickness as it will thicken faster with dairy.
How long does this chocolate sauce keep fresh?
Stored in an airtight container in the refrigerator, this sauce stays fresh for up to two weeks. Always check for any off smells or mold before using.
Is this sauce suitable for vegans?
Yes, this recipe is vegan-friendly as written, using only plant-based ingredients. Just ensure your vanilla extract is vegan certified if that matters to you.
Can I make this chocolate sauce less sweet?
Definitely! Feel free to reduce the sugar to suit your taste. Keep in mind that lowering the sugar too much might affect the sauce’s thickness and texture.
What are some other uses for this Homemade Chocolate Sauce Recipe?
Beyond desserts, this sauce is fantastic drizzled on oatmeal, swirled into smoothie bowls, or even used as a dip for pretzels and cookies, making it delightfully versatile.
Final Thoughts
I genuinely hope this Homemade Chocolate Sauce Recipe finds a warm spot in your kitchen and heart. It’s such a simple joy to make and share, instantly transforming everyday treats into something special. Give it a try, and prepare to fall in love with how effortlessly delicious homemade chocolate magic can be!
Print
Homemade Chocolate Sauce Recipe
- Prep Time: 5 minutes
- Cook Time: 5 minutes
- Total Time: 10 minutes
- Yield: 1 1/2 cups
- Category: Sauce
- Method: Stovetop
- Cuisine: American
- Diet: Vegetarian
Description
This homemade chocolate sauce recipe offers a rich, smooth, and versatile syrup perfect for drizzling over ice cream, pancakes, waffles, or mixing into chocolate milk. Made from simple pantry ingredients like cocoa powder, sugar, and vanilla, it’s easy to prepare on the stovetop and stores well in the refrigerator for up to two weeks.
Ingredients
Chocolate Sauce Ingredients
- 1 cup unsweetened cocoa powder
- 1 cup granulated sugar
- 1 cup water
- 1/4 teaspoon salt
- 1 teaspoon vanilla extract
Instructions
- Combine dry ingredients: In a medium saucepan, whisk together the cocoa powder, sugar, and salt to ensure all dry ingredients are evenly mixed.
- Add water gradually: Slowly pour in the water while continually whisking to create a smooth and lump-free mixture.
- Heat mixture: Place the saucepan over medium heat and bring the mixture to a gentle boil, stirring frequently to prevent burning and ensure even heating.
- Simmer the sauce: Reduce the heat to low and let the sauce simmer for 4 to 5 minutes, stirring occasionally until it thickens slightly to a syrupy consistency.
- Add vanilla and cool: Remove the saucepan from heat and stir in the vanilla extract. Allow the sauce to cool before transferring it to a jar or bottle.
- Storage: Store the chocolate sauce in the refrigerator for up to 2 weeks. Reheat gently if needed before serving.
Notes
- The sauce will thicken further as it cools, so don’t worry if it looks a bit thin when hot.
- Reheat gently in the microwave or on the stovetop to restore pourable consistency.
- Use as a delicious topping for ice cream, pancakes, waffles, or as a mix-in for chocolate milk.

